..."YOU! HOW DARE YOU DODGE! YOU FILTHY COMMONER!"

Basil prepared yet another fireball and hurled it towards the kneeling Odrunn. A hand made out of stone reached out and completely blocked the fireball.

"That's quite enough Mr Basil, please leave the hall and head back to your dorm." It was Principal Davenport, his hand slowly reverting back into its normal appearance.

Basil turned around and scowled as he shouted,

"little fat commoner, I will destroy you and that skinny freak who helped you out just now."

Z turned to look at Soli and the pigtail girl, after all, he had seen what happened. Soli turned her head away instantly and the pigtail girl stuck out her tongue blowing a raspberry.

"Oof!"

Z felt like his ribs were going to break as the huge Odrunn rushed forward and hugged him from the back lifting him up entirely.

"Thank you for saving me! Your kick saved my life, from today onwards you will be my boss wherever you go, I will follow you!"

Zero felt the hairs on the back of his neck stand on ends, as he felt the stares of all the students turn towards his direction. He let out a sigh and resigned to fate that he for sure had met the god of misfortune.

Shortly after the incident, the nobles returned to their seats as the commoners continued walking along to be tested. The commoners outnumber the nobilities by a large. Meaning, that even if they weren't sent to the military as meatshields or doing manual labour as the militia, they would have very little chance to be commanders of their own unit, mostly ending up as underlings to some better privileged Noble.

A huge number of commoner students went on stage and mostly got Tier D and E with a minority as Tier U and a rare few reaching B and C, Odrunn stepped up to the detector next. Still affected by almost being burnt to a crisp, the loud-mouthed Odrunn went up quietly like a mouse.

"Odrunn Braveflight, E Tier"

Odrunn felt tears coming out of his eyes as he blushed. He had never been so embarrassed all his life, the words he spoke earlier only served as a slap to his face.

"Looks like the crowd will chant his name Odrunn! Odrunn! The loser!" one of the girls who listened to his big talk earlier mocked him.

"How dare he make fun of great master Basil when he is such a weakling" another one of the girls mocked him.

Soon, the entire hall was in an uproar.

One of Basil's underling smirked and spoke up.

"Okay quiet down! He is a useful member of our school, Odrunn, we'll look for you later and we can have a spar, we'll need you as a punching bag Hahaha.."

A shiver ran down Odrunn's spine as he thought of his days of endless torment in the school.

"M...my boss will get a good Tier, you'll see. He will protect me."

At the side, Z sighed. He never expected to get so much attention just by being next to Odrunn on the first day. He knew that with the busker's manifest to mask his abilities, he was bound to be U tier. But a hint of anxiety was gripping onto him, afraid that he might not be able to get through the detection.

It was soon Z's turn. Stepping up, his thoughts jumbled and he started to think of a plan B, worried that if his plan fails, he would be taken away. He prayed silently in his heart, hoping that the manifest would not let him down. His entire plan hinging on him staying in the academy instead of being taken away to that godforsaken incubator.

Stepping forward, one foot at a time zero walked in front of the detector he put his hand on the Machine as the Envoy's voice sounded out.

"Zero Cromwell, U Tier"

Hearing this, Zero let out a sigh of relief almost busting out a smile, while Odrunn face turned pale. The crowd exploded in a discussion as the student body started to mock him

"looks like the boss of trash is an even bigger trash. You are the boss of the trash. Hahahahha"

"looks like they are made for each other so useless."

"The both of you better watch your back!" One of the lackeys from Basil's side spoke out.

Z, wasn't embarrassed by the weird looks or the mocking that his classmates were throwing at him. He was after all an adult despite his body now, even without training, he was confident that if he was fighting the principal, even if he couldn't win he could run away at the very least. At this moment, however, he was feeling exhilarated that his plan worked. Avoiding the incubator was step one of his plans. Now that this was in motion, he just had to survive in the academy and make sure he manages to graduate and get a good rank before starting to climb higher in the military.

Z calmly walked off the stage moving into the crowds of students, ignoring whatever buzz was going on and waited patiently as they were issued their lodging. The nobility would often provide hefty donations to the academy, so the academy was always equipped with a pre-owned lodging for the noble children.

As for the rest, the academy compound consisted of a very large space, students at the academy was provided for in terms of food, usually for the poorer students, just nutrition bars and lodging, special serums to improve control over their manifests were sold by an exorbitant amount of Academy credits or given as special rewards. As for allowances, students will be given Academy credits that were issued through their communications watch for merit.

As for the quality of food and lodging, it depended on potential. Needless to say, the tiers play a vital role and the U tiers and E tiers are paid the least and their quality of life is worse off, for Zero however the lodging and food are the least of his worries.

Somewhere around campus, a voice could be heard communicating through the communications watch.

"Esteemed Grandfather, it's me. It seems the young heir of the Steelhammer group is here as well. What are your orders!"

Another voice, thin and muffled replied from the watch

"It would be a shame for the young son of the Steelhammer group to pass away in an accident in the academy, but if that should happen, it would seem that it would be in our greatest interest."

"I won't fail you Grandfather!" The silhouette ended the conversation as he continued to look out through the window of his lavish room.

___________________________________________________________

'Tent number 231, West wing. It says it's a 2 person sharing tent. As long as the other party doesn't get in my way, we'll get along just fine.' Z thought to himself.

He pushed the door of the tent aside and went in, it was slipshod and the ground was full of gravel, but what kind of condition hasn't Z seen before. As long as there was something similar to a bed, everything would be fine.

The tent flap started to rustle as the door opened once again..
